Ryerss Open To Visitors

Ryerss Farm for Aged Equines, 1710 Ridge Road (Route 23), Pottstown, is open to visitors daily from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m.

Ryerss Farm cares for more than 75 aged, abused or injured horses, providing a home with 383 acres where they can spend their golden years. The horses at Ryerss are never worked or ridden again.

Visitors may feed the horses treats that are sold in the Ryerss gift shop, which are specially formulated for senior horses. Visitors should not bring treats from home.
